Young Voices
Bassingham Primary School is proud to have participated in the Young Voices programme for the past three years. Young Voices brings music education to life on an incredible scale, providing children with the opportunity to perform as part of the largest children’s choir concerts in the world.
Taking to the stage alongside 5,000–8,000 other young singers, our pupils perform to capacity audiences of family and friends in an unforgettable celebration of music. Singing as part of such a large choir, with their classmates and friends beside them, helps to develop self-belief, confidence, resilience and teamwork. It also encourages children to communicate effectively, support one another and experience the joy of achieving something truly special together.
Beyond the excitement of the concert itself, regular rehearsals provide numerous benefits for children’s wellbeing and development. Through singing and breathing exercises, pupils improve their focus, concentration and emotional wellbeing, while also developing their musical skills and a lifelong appreciation of music.
The Young Voices experience is an inspiring opportunity that enables our children to grow as confident performers, enthusiastic musicians and valued members of a team.
